Market Overview
Global Epoxy
Adhesives market was valued at USD 8.46 Billion in 2024 and is expected
to reach USD 11.70 Billion by 2030 with a CAGR of 5.55%. The global epoxy
adhesives market is witnessing consistent growth, underpinned by its extensive
cross-industry applicability and the rising demand for high-performance,
structural bonding solutions. Renowned for their superior mechanical strength,
chemical resistance, and long-term durability, epoxy adhesives are
indispensable in applications that require robust and reliable bonding under
extreme conditions.
Their usage
spans a wide array of critical industries, including automotive and
transportation, where they support lightweighting and EV battery integration; construction,
for anchoring and panel bonding; electronics, where thermal stability and
precision bonding are crucial; and sectors like aerospace, renewable energy
(notably wind turbines), and marine, where environmental exposure and
mechanical stress necessitate high-performance adhesives.
As material
science continues to advance, and industries demand more efficient,
sustainable, and application-specific solutions, the epoxy adhesives market is
well-positioned for long-term expansion. Manufacturers that invest in targeted
R&D, regionalized production infrastructure, and low-emission or recyclable
adhesive technologies will gain a competitive edge in capturing future market
share across both mature and emerging economies.
Key Market Drivers
Expansion of the Building
& Construction Sector
The
expansion of the building and construction sector is a significant driver of
growth in the global epoxy adhesives market, fueled by rising urbanization,
infrastructure modernization, and a growing preference for high-performance
construction materials. Epoxy adhesives are increasingly being adopted in
residential, commercial, industrial, and infrastructure projects due to their
exceptional mechanical strength, durability, and resistance to environmental
stressors. While infrastructure development continues at pace, India remains
acutely focused on integrating climate action into its growth strategy. The
government has implemented a series of targeted measures to mitigate climate
risks, which has contributed to a notable improvement in the country’s Sustainable
Development Goals (SDG) Index score from 57 in 2019 to 66 in 2021. Across
both developed and developing economies, there is a surge in infrastructure
investments, including smart cities, high-rise buildings, bridges, tunnels,
airports, and transportation networks. Governments and private developers are
investing heavily in large-scale infrastructure to support growing populations
and economic activity. Epoxy adhesives are used extensively for structural
bonding, anchoring, and grouting, particularly in demanding applications such
as bridge decking, precast panel installation, and flooring systems. This
sustained construction boom is significantly increasing the consumption of
epoxy adhesives in structural and civil engineering applications.
Construction
projects today demand long-lasting and high-performance materials that can
withstand harsh weather conditions, moisture, chemical exposure, and mechanical
stress. Epoxy adhesives fulfill these requirements with their High tensile and
shear strength, Excellent moisture and chemical resistance, Thermal and UV
stability. As a result, they are widely used for tile and stone fixing, facade
installation, structural glazing, sealing expansion joints, and bonding
concrete or metal components especially in commercial and industrial settings. With
the growing focus on sustainability and energy efficiency, builders are
adopting materials that align with green building certifications (such as LEED
and BREEAM). Epoxy adhesives are available in low-VOC and solvent-free
formulations, making them suitable for eco-friendly construction. These
adhesives contribute to air quality compliance, low environmental impact, and
improved building lifecycle performance, further driving their adoption in
modern construction. Epoxy adhesives are an integral component of epoxy
flooring systems, which are widely used in commercial, industrial, and
healthcare facilities due to their seamless finish, hygiene, abrasion
resistance, and load-bearing capacity. These floor coatings are particularly
valued in warehouses, hospitals, food processing plants, parking decks, and
factories, where cleanliness and durability are paramount. Epoxy adhesives also
play a role in floor tile and panel installation, offering long-lasting bond
strength and chemical resistance.
Boom in Electronics and
Electrical Manufacturing
The
boom in electronics and electrical manufacturing is one of the most influential
drivers accelerating the growth of the global epoxy adhesives market. As the
demand for compact, high-performance, and durable electronic devices increases,
manufacturers are turning to advanced bonding solutions particularly epoxy
adhesives for their mechanical strength, insulation properties, and reliability
in harsh operating conditions. Smartphones now account for approximately 90%
of all mobile phones in use globally, reflecting their dominance in the mobile
device landscape. With over 7.2 billion smartphones currently in circulation,
ownership has reached a point where most of the global population possesses one.
The global consumer electronics market is experiencing rapid growth, driven by
increasing demand for smartphones, tablets, laptops, wearable devices, and home
automation systems. These compact devices require high-precision assembly using
adhesives that can provide strong bonds while occupying minimal space. Epoxy
adhesives offer excellent adhesion to a variety of substrates, including
metals, plastics, and glass. Their low shrinkage, thermal resistance, and
electrical insulation properties make them ideal for bonding internal
components like screens, circuit boards, sensors, and casings. As consumers
continue to demand smaller, lighter, and more feature-rich gadgets, epoxy
adhesives play a critical role in enabling miniaturization and performance
reliability.
Epoxy
adhesives are extensively used in the assembly and encapsulation of printed
circuit boards (PCBs), semiconductors, and microelectronic components. These
components require adhesives that ensure strong adhesion, thermal conductivity,
and electrical insulation while withstanding high temperatures and vibration. In
semiconductor packaging, epoxy compounds are used to encapsulate chips,
protecting them from environmental damage and mechanical stress. In PCB
manufacturing, epoxies are applied for bonding layers, coating surfaces, and
attaching components, ensuring electromechanical stability and corrosion
resistance. With increasing investment in AI, 5G infrastructure, edge
computing, and smart sensors, the need for reliable electronic bonding
materials continues to surge. The global electric vehicle (EV) fleet has
surged to nearly 60 million units, more than doubling from 26 million in 2022. The
rise of electric mobility has significantly boosted demand for epoxy adhesives
in battery assembly, power electronics, and motor components. EV batteries
require adhesives that can withstand thermal cycles, mechanical shocks, and
corrosive environments. Epoxy adhesives provide thermal management, structural
bonding, and insulation in battery cells and modules. They also offer flame
retardancy and vibration resistance, making them essential in securing EV
battery packs, inverters, and charging systems. As EV adoption grows globally,
epoxy adhesives are becoming a core enabler in the safe and efficient design of
next-generation vehicles.
The
global shift toward Industry 4.0 and smart manufacturing is leading to
increased use of sensors, robotics, and control systems all of which depend on
reliable electrical and electronic assemblies. Epoxy adhesives are used in
bonding sensors, LED displays, camera modules, and signal processors, where
performance consistency is non-negotiable. Their resistance to thermal stress,
humidity, and electromagnetic interference (EMI) makes them indispensable in
industrial electronics. The growing integration of IoT devices in everything
from home appliances to smart factories further expands the application scope
of epoxy adhesives.

Key Market Challenges
Environmental and Regulatory
Pressures
One
of the most critical challenges facing the epoxy adhesives market is increasing
scrutiny over environmental sustainability, health hazards, and regulatory
compliance. Traditional epoxy adhesives, especially solvent-based or
bisphenol-A (BPA)-containing formulations, are associated with the release of
volatile organic compounds (VOCs) and other hazardous substances during
application and curing.
Stringent
regulations in regions such as Europe (REACH), North America (EPA), and parts
of Asia are tightening permissible VOC limits and encouraging the use of
greener alternatives. Rising awareness about worker safety and indoor air
quality is prompting industries to reduce or eliminate solvent-based adhesives.
This growing regulatory burden is pushing manufacturers to reformulate
products, invest in low-VOC, water-based, or bio-based epoxy adhesives, and
comply with evolving environmental norms often at higher R&D and production
costs, which could deter adoption in cost-sensitive markets.
Raw Material Price Volatility
and Supply Chain Disruptions
Epoxy
adhesives rely on several petrochemical-derived raw materials, such as epoxy
resins, hardeners, and curing agents, whose prices are subject to frequent
fluctuations based on global oil prices, geopolitical tensions, and trade
dynamics.
Disruptions
in the supply chain especially during events like COVID-19, geopolitical
conflicts, and trade restrictions have caused material shortages, extended lead
times, and increased costs. Emerging markets, which are rapidly scaling up
infrastructure and industrialization, are particularly sensitive to such price
shifts, affecting the consistency and profitability of epoxy adhesive
consumption. Volatile input costs and uncertain supply chains force
manufacturers and end-users to rethink sourcing strategies, explore
alternatives, or delay large-scale adhesive-dependent projects thereby
restraining overall market growth.
Key Market Trends
Integration of Smart and
Functional Epoxy Adhesives
A
significant trend gaining momentum is the development and adoption of smart
epoxy adhesives formulations embedded with functional properties that go beyond
bonding. These advanced adhesives are designed to respond to external stimuli
such as heat, pressure, or electrical signals, enabling new use cases in
high-tech industries.
For
example, self-sensing adhesives can monitor structural integrity in aerospace
or civil infrastructure applications by detecting cracks, delamination, or
stress. Thermally conductive and electrically insulating epoxies are finding
growing use in electric vehicles (EVs), power electronics, and battery systems,
where they enhance performance while protecting components. In high-precision
fields like microelectronics and photonics, epoxy adhesives are being
engineered with optical clarity, EMI shielding, and low outgassing properties,
essential for mission-critical assemblies. This trend reflects a shift from
adhesives as passive bonding agents to active, multifunctional materials that
enhance the performance, reliability, and intelligence of the final product.
Customization and
Application-Specific Formulations
As
industries evolve, there is a rising demand for tailor-made epoxy adhesive
solutions that are optimized for specific performance, processing, and
environmental conditions. Instead of offering standard
"one-size-fits-all" products, manufacturers are collaborating closely
with end-users to co-develop adhesives with custom rheology, cure profiles,
temperature resistance, and surface compatibility.
In
aerospace and defense, ultra-lightweight, high-temperature-resistant adhesives
are being engineered to meet strict regulatory and safety standards. In
construction and infrastructure, epoxy adhesives are being modified for fast
curing in humid or sub-zero conditions addressing regional climate challenges. In
consumer electronics, formulations are being refined for ultra-thin bonding
layers that maintain adhesion without adding bulk or affecting thermal
management. This growing trend of customer-centric formulation development is
enabling faster innovation cycles, better product differentiation, and deeper
market penetration across niche applications.
Segmental Insights
Technology Insights
Based
on the category of Technology, the Two Component segment emerged as the fastest
growing in the market for Epoxy Adhesives in 2024. Two-component epoxy
adhesives consist of a resin and a hardener that must be mixed before
application. This system offers significantly stronger adhesion, enhanced
chemical and environmental resistance, and superior mechanical properties
compared to single-component formulations. These adhesives provide long-term
stability and high shear strength, making them ideal for bonding metals,
composites, plastics, and ceramics in demanding applications. The
customizability of cure times and working life allows for tailored solutions
depending on application requirements, ranging from fast-setting formulas to
slow-curing, high-performance variants.
Two-component
epoxies are increasingly used in structural applications where high mechanical
strength and durability are essential. Industries such as automotive,
aerospace, construction, marine, and wind energy rely heavily on these
adhesives for load-bearing joints and critical assemblies. In the automotive
sector, they are used for bonding car frames, body panels, and composite parts
to enhance crash resistance and reduce vehicle weight. In aerospace, they
support the bonding of lightweight composites, offering both strength and
fatigue resistance under extreme conditions. Wind energy applications use
two-component epoxies for bonding turbine blades and nacelles, where mechanical
performance is critical.
The
growth of advanced manufacturing and assembly processes has accelerated the
adoption of two-component epoxies. As automation and precision increase,
manufacturers demand adhesives that offer consistent curing, minimal shrinkage,
and thermal/electrical insulation properties, all of which are well-served by
this technology. Their gap-filling capabilities and resistance to heat,
moisture, and vibration make them ideal for industrial machinery, tools, and
equipment assembly. These factors contribute to the growth of this segment.

Regional Insights
Asia Pacific emerged as the largest market in the global Epoxy Adhesives market in
2024, holding the largest market share in terms of value. Asia Pacific is
experiencing rapid industrialization, especially in countries such as China,
India, Vietnam, Indonesia, and Thailand. This transformation is fueling demand
for advanced bonding solutions in construction, automotive, electronics, and
general manufacturing. Epoxy adhesives are preferred due to their superior
mechanical strength, chemical resistance, and excellent adhesion to a variety
of substrates. Massive infrastructure projects, urban housing developments, and
smart city initiatives are significantly increasing the use of epoxy adhesives
for flooring, panel bonding, and structural reinforcement. Asia Pacific
accounts for a significant share of global automobile production. The
lightweighting trend and growing use of composite materials in vehicles are
driving demand for structural adhesives like epoxy.
Asia
Pacific is a global powerhouse for electronics manufacturing, particularly in
countries such as China, South Korea, Japan, and Taiwan. Epoxy adhesives are
widely used in printed circuit boards (PCBs), semiconductor packaging, and
electronic assembly due to their excellent insulation and bonding properties. The
ongoing demand for consumer electronics, 5G devices, EV batteries, and compact,
high-performance gadgets further accelerates market growth.
Low
labor costs, supportive government policies, and availability of raw materials
have made Asia Pacific an attractive manufacturing destination. This has led
many global epoxy adhesive producers to either expand their footprint or
establish regional manufacturing facilities. Foreign Direct Investment (FDI)
and policy-driven incentives in India, Vietnam, and China are bolstering
industrial and infrastructure developments, thereby increasing epoxy adhesive
consumption.
Recent Developments
- In
May 2025, Ellsworth Adhesives has entered into a distribution agreement with 3M
to supply its Scotch-Weld™ One-Part Epoxy Adhesives 6101 and 6102, aimed at
enhancing performance in electronics assembly applications. This collaboration
is designed to meet growing industry demand for streamlined, high-reliability
bonding and sealing solutions that support next-generation electronic design
and production efficiency. By leveraging Ellsworth’s global distribution
network and technical expertise, the partnership will enable broader access to
3M’s advanced epoxy technologies across critical electronics manufacturing
markets.
- In
February 2025, Panacol has announced the launch of Structalit® 5859, a newly
developed epoxy adhesive specifically engineered for high-strength magnet
bonding in demanding applications. Designed for precision use in
magnet-to-rotor assembly and magnet fixation within pole housings, Structalit®
5859 delivers robust mechanical performance and long-term durability under
operational stress. This product addresses the stringent bonding requirements
in electric motor and generator manufacturing, offering a reliable solution for
maintaining magnetic alignment and structural integrity in compact assemblies.
- In
July 2024, Henkel Adhesive Technologies India Private Limited (Henkel India)
has successfully completed Phase III expansion of its state-of-the-art
manufacturing facility in Kurkumbh, Maharashtra, strengthening its domestic
production capabilities. Commissioned in 2020, the Kurkumbh plant plays a
strategic role in supplying high-performance adhesives, sealants, and surface
treatment solutions tailored to the evolving needs of Indian industries. The
latest phase enhances Henkel’s operational footprint to support sector-specific
demand across automotive, industrial, and consumer segments, reinforcing its
commitment to localized, scalable manufacturing in India.
- In
September 2023, Researchers at EMPA’s Advanced Fibers Laboratory have
engineered a flame-resistant epoxy resin-based plastic that is both fully
recyclable and repairable, marking a significant advancement in sustainable
thermoset materials. Unlike conventional epoxy systems, the new formulation
maintains the high thermomechanical performance expected of structural epoxy
resins, while enabling closed-loop recyclability and in-situ repair. This
innovation addresses key industry challenges in sectors such as aerospace,
automotive, and electronics, where fire safety, material longevity, and
environmental responsibility are increasingly critical.
